Understanding the Mercedes Ignition System

Unlike traditional vehicles that use mechanical ignition switches, modern Mercedes cars rely on electronic ignition systems. This system uses an Electronic Ignition Switch (EIS) module that communicates with the key fob and vehicle control modules.

When the key is inserted or detected by the vehicle, the system performs several authentication checks before allowing the engine to start.

These components work together:

  • Key fob transponder chip

  • Electronic Ignition Switch (EIS)

  • Electronic Steering Lock (ESL)

  • Engine Control Unit (ECU)

Common Signs of Ignition Switch Problems

Drivers often experience early warning signs before a complete ignition failure occurs.

Key Will Not Turn

One of the most common symptoms is when the key inserts but does not rotate or activate the ignition system.

Steering Wheel Remains Locked

Mercedes vehicles include an electronic steering lock that must disengage before the ignition activates. Failure of this system may require mercedes benz ignition switch repair.

Dashboard Lights Do Not Turn On

If the dashboard remains dark when the key is inserted, the ignition system may not be receiving power or authorization.

Intermittent Starting Issues

Vehicles that start occasionally but fail at other times often have underlying ignition module problems.

Why Ignition Switch Issues Occur

Several factors can lead to ignition switch failure in Mercedes vehicles.

Electronic Component Wear

Over time, internal circuitry inside the ignition module can degrade due to heat and electrical stress.

Voltage Problems

Weak batteries or electrical surges can damage sensitive electronic components.

Key Communication Errors

If the key fob cannot properly communicate with the ignition module, the system may block engine startup.

Steering Lock Failure
